Fields of activity | Technical Mathematician

As a technical mathematician, you’ll apply mathematical concepts, models, and methods to analyze and solve complex technical problems. You’ll develop abstract models for real-world applications in fields such as astronomy, electrical engineering, or mechanical engineering.

Your role of a technical mathematician encompasses various tasks in both research and industry. You may calculate forces and effects, such as airflow around a vehicle or the impact of a collision. Additionally, your expertise will be essential for analyzing large datasets and managing technical databases.

Potential jobs | Technical Mathematician

As a technical mathematician, you’ll primarily work at a computer. Career opportunities span a wide range of industries, including aerospace, mechanical engineering, and the automotive sector. Alternatively, you may find employment in fields such as electrical engineering, biotechnology, or industrial engineering. Your expertise will also be highly sought after in research institutions or public authorities.
